Chapter 16 Antispam control of the SMTP server3. In the If the message has invalid Caller ID, then section, set spam rating to 3 points (asexplained above, spam messages are tested and scored by multiple tests so it is not recommendedto block it or to set individual scores too high).4. It is also recommended to enable the Apply this policy also to the testing Caller ID recordsoption since most servers which employ the Caller ID technology use its testing mode sofar.5. If you use an alternative (backup) SMTP server, specify its address in the Don’t check CallerID from IP address group entry.SPFFor closer description of the SPF technology, refer chapter 16.5. Recommended settings of theSPF test is almost identical with the Caller ID settings. It is as follows:1. Open the SPF tab under Configuration → Content Filtering → Spam Filter).2. Enable the SPF check of every incoming message option.3. In the If the message has invalid Caller ID, then section, set spam rating to 3 points (asexplained above, spam messages are tested and scored by multiple tests so it is not recommendedto block it or to set individual scores too high).4. If you use a backup SMTP server, enter its address in Don’t check SPF from IP addressgroup.It is also recommended to support SPF by adding a record regarding SMTP servers which areallowed to send email from your domains to your DNS records.Spam repellentDetailed information on <strong>Kerio</strong> MailServer’s Spam repellent technology, refer to chapter 16.6.This technology is not involved in spam rating and it is therefore only mentioned in thissection. The technology usually sorts out large volume of spam even before it is accepted in<strong>Kerio</strong> MailServer and thus decrease the load on the antispam tests and on the mailserver inparticular.The optimal settings of Spam repellent are as follows:1. Open the Spam Repellent tab under Configuration → Content Filtering → Spam Filter).2. Enable the Delay SMTP greeting by ... seconds option and set the value to 25 seconds.192
